8、10-2A National Concrete Masonry Association,Con-trol Joints for Concrete Masonry Walls4Standard Practice for Bracing Masonry Walls Under Con-struction,Masonry Contractors Association of America53.Storage3.1 Deliver and store surface bonding mortar in originalcontainers off the ground to prevent cont

9、act with water.Protectfrom rain with suitable covering.3.2 Store concrete masonry units off the ground to preventcontamination by mud,dust,and materials likely to causestaining or other defects,and protect from rain.4.Materials and Manufacture4.1 Concrete masonry units shall be clean and shall meet

10、therequirements of either Specifications C55,C90,or C129.Thesurface to receive surface bonding mortar shall be free of paint,oil,efflorescence,or foreign materials that interfere withbonding.4.2 Surface bonding mortar shall meet the requirements ofSpecification C887.If the dry mix contains hard lump

11、s,it shallnot be used.4.3 Leveling course shall be bedded with a mortar meetingeither Specification C270 or Specification C887.4.4 Shims shall be corrosion-resistant metal or plastic witha minimum compressive strength of 2000 psi(13.8 MPa),orsteel protected from corrosion by a coating of zinc at lea
